The Rise of Premium Digital Casino Experiences
In the digital age, online casinos are no longer simple websites offering basic slots and table games. Instead, they have evolved into comprehensive, highly styled platforms that incorporate live dealer interactions, virtual reality (VR), and gamification strategies. According to industry data from the European Gaming & Betting Association, the online gambling market in the UK alone generated over £5.8 billion in revenue during 2022, with a significant proportion attributable to premium, user-centric platforms.

The Critical Role of Responsible Gaming
As online gambling becomes more accessible, concerns around problem gambling and financial risk also escalate. Industry leaders recognize that fostering a responsible gambling environment is essential not only for regulatory compliance but also for long-term sustainability. Genuine platforms incorporate features such as deposit limits, self-assessment tools, and real-time alerts that promote safe gaming habits.
“Responsible gambling isn’t just a regulatory checkbox; it’s a core pillar that underpins trust in digital betting environments,” notes Dr. Emily Richards, a behavioural psychologist specialising in gambling addiction.
Innovation and Regulation: The Balancing Act
Regulatory frameworks across the UK and wider Europe are becoming more sophisticated, aiming to strike a balance between market freedom and consumer protection. The UK Gambling Commission (UKGC)’s recent updates stipulate stringent anti-money laundering policies, age verification processes, and player protection measures. Simultaneously, innovation in game design and payment options, such as cryptocurrencies, are reshaping the experience.
